Portrait of an Anonymous Sitter: A Window Into Impressionistic Elegance

Pierre-Auguste Renoir’s “Portrait of an Anonymous Sitter,” painted in 1875, transcends mere representation; it embodies the very spirit of Impressionism—a fleeting glimpse into a moment captured with luminous brushstrokes and vibrant color. More than just depicting a woman's likeness, the painting delves into the subtleties of emotion and atmosphere, inviting contemplation on beauty and quiet introspection.

Compositional Harmony and Spatial Depth

Renoir skillfully orchestrates his canvas, establishing a harmonious balance between figure and background. The central subject—a woman with long hair elegantly styled—dominates the frame, her gaze directed intently toward an unseen object in her hand. This gesture speaks volumes about inner focus and contemplation. Two chairs flank the composition, one positioned slightly to the right and another further left, creating a sense of depth and grounding the figure within its environment. A book resting on a surface near the bottom left corner subtly reinforces this spatial dimension, hinting at intellectual pursuits alongside aesthetic appreciation. The artist’s meticulous attention to detail contributes to an overall feeling of serenity and refined composure.

Impressionistic Techniques: Light and Texture

The hallmark of Renoir's approach is his masterful use of Impressionist techniques—a deliberate departure from academic conventions that prioritized precise realism. Instead, he employs short, broken brushstrokes layered upon each other, capturing the ephemeral quality of light as it dances across surfaces. Observe how Renoir renders the woman’s skin with soft, diffused tones, skillfully blending colors to achieve a velvety texture. The background is treated with looser strokes, conveying an impressionistic sense of space and atmosphere—a hazy suggestion of interior décor rather than a detailed depiction. This technique isn't merely stylistic; it aims to convey the sensory experience of observing the scene firsthand.

Historical Context: The Rise of Modern Portraiture

Portrait painting experienced a significant transformation during the latter half of the 19th century, moving away from formal portraits commissioned by royalty and nobility toward more accessible depictions of middle-class individuals. Artists like Renoir embraced this shift, exploring themes of domestic life and capturing intimate moments with sensitivity. The Impressionist movement itself arose in reaction to the rigid rules of the Salon system—a challenge to established artistic norms that championed spontaneity and subjective perception. “Portrait of an Anonymous Sitter” stands as a testament to this evolving aesthetic landscape, reflecting the burgeoning interest in portraying everyday life with nuance and beauty.
